@Tania-75  Welcome to the Community, I had an issue some time ago where my Ionic was draining quicker than usual 5 days I would get from each charging cycle. I gave it a full recharge and done several restarts in succession by pressing and holding the left and bottom right buttons until the Fitbit emblem appears triggering the reboot  After that it was fine and as rule now I always give my Ionic a reboot after each charge. 

 

If you are not using one of the official Fitbit watch faces, I would recommend swapping to one of those too as some of the 3rd party ones can cause faster battery drains.
